System.Security.AccessControl 名前空間とは? わかりやすく解説

Weblio 辞書 > コンピュータ > .NET Framework クラス ライブラリ リファレンス > System.Security.AccessControl 名前空間の意味・解説 

System.Security.AccessControl 名前空間

メモ : この名前空間は、.NET Framework version 2.0新しく追加されたものです。

System.Security.AccessControl 名前空間は、セキュリティ設定できるオブジェクトについて、これらのオブジェクトへのアクセス制御したり、セキュリティ関連操作監査したりするプログラミング要素提供します
クラスクラス

 クラス説明
パブリック クラスAccessRuleユーザー IDアクセス マスクアクセス制御種類 (許可または拒否) の組み合わせ表します。AccessRule オブジェクトには、子オブジェクトによる規則継承方法継承反映方法に関する情報格納されます。
パブリック クラスAceEnumeratorアクセス制御リスト (ACL: Access Control List) 内のアクセス制御エントリ (ACE: Access Control Entry) を反復処理する機能提供します
パブリック クラスAuditRuleユーザーIDアクセス マスク組み合わせ表します。AuditRule オブジェクトには、子オブジェクト規則継承する方法継承反映方法監査必要な条件などの情報格納されます。
パブリック クラスAuthorizationRuleセキュリティ設定できるオブジェクトへのアクセス決定しますAccessRule 派生クラスおよび AuditRule 派生クラスは、アクセスおよび監査特化した機能提供します
パブリック クラスAuthorizationRuleCollectionAuthorizationRule オブジェクトコレクション表します
パブリック クラスCommonAceアクセス制御エントリ (ACE: Access Control Entry) を表します
パブリック クラスCommonAclアクセス制御リスト (ACL: Access Control List) を表します。このクラスは、DiscretionaryAcl クラスおよび SystemAcl クラス基本クラスです。
パブリック クラスCommonObjectSecurityアクセス制御リスト (ACL: Access Control List) を直接操作せずにオブジェクトへのアクセス制御します。このクラスは、NativeObjectSecurity クラス抽象基本クラスです。
パブリック クラスCommonSecurityDescriptorセキュリティ記述子表しますセキュリティ記述子には、所有者プライマリ グループ随意アクセス制御リスト (DACL: Discretionary Access Control List)、システム アクセス制御リスト (SACL: System Access Control List) が含まれます。
パブリック クラスCompoundAce複合アクセス制御エントリ (ACE: Access Control Entry) を表します
パブリック クラスCryptoKeyAccessRule暗号化キーアクセス規則表しますアクセス規則は、ユーザー IDアクセス マスクアクセス制御種類 (許可または拒否) の組み合わせ表しますアクセス規則オブジェクトには、子オブジェクトによる規則継承方法継承反映方法に関する情報格納されます。
パブリック クラスCryptoKeyAuditRule暗号化キー監査規則表します監査規則は、ユーザーIDアクセス マスク組み合わせ表します監査規則には、子オブジェクト規則継承する方法継承反映方法監査必要な条件に関する情報格納されます。
パブリック クラスCryptoKeySecurityアクセス制御リスト (ACL: Access Control List) を直接操作せずに暗号化キー オブジェクトへのアクセス制御する機能提供します
パブリック クラスCustomAceAceType 列挙体のメンバによって定義されていないアクセス制御エントリ (ACE: Access Control Entry) を表します
パブリック クラスDirectoryObjectSecurityアクセス制御リスト (ACE: Access Control Lists) を直接操作せずにディレクトリ オブジェクトへのアクセス制御する機能提供します
パブリック クラスDirectorySecurityディレクトリアクセス制御と監査セキュリティ表します。このクラス継承できません。
パブリック クラスDiscretionaryAcl随意アクセス制御リスト (DACL: Discretionary Access Control List) を表します
パブリック クラスEventWaitHandleAccessRuleユーザーまたはグループ許可されアクセス権セットまたは拒否されアクセス権セット表します。このクラス継承できません。
パブリック クラスEventWaitHandleAuditRuleユーザーまたはグループについて監査するアクセス権セット表します。このクラス継承できません。
パブリック クラスEventWaitHandleSecurity前付システム待機ハンドル適用する Windows アクセス制御セキュリティ表します。このクラス継承できません。
パブリック クラスFileSecurityファイルアクセス制御および監査セキュリティ表します。このクラス継承できません。
パブリック クラスFileSystemAccessRuleファイルまたはディレクトリアクセス規則定義するアクセス制御エントリ (ACE: Access Control Entry) の抽象化表します。このクラス継承できません。
パブリック クラスFileSystemAuditRuleファイルまたはディレクトリ監査規則定義するアクセス制御エントリ (ACE: Access Control Entry) の抽象化表します。このクラス継承できません。
パブリック クラスFileSystemSecurityファイルまたはディレクトリアクセス制御と監査セキュリティ表します
パブリック クラスGenericAceアクセス制御エントリ (ACE: Access Control Entry) を表します。このクラスは、他のすべての ACE クラス基本クラスです。
パブリック クラスGenericAclアクセス制御リスト (ACL: Access Control List) を表しますまた、CommonAcl、DiscretionaryAcl、RawAcl、および SystemAcl の各クラス基本クラスです。
パブリック クラスGenericSecurityDescriptorセキュリティ記述子表しますセキュリティ記述子には、所有者プライマリ グループ随意アクセス制御リスト (DACL: Discretionary Access Control List)、システム アクセス制御リスト (SACL: System Access Control List) が含まれます。
パブリック クラスKnownAce現在 Microsoft Corporation によって定義されているすべてのアクセス制御エントリ (ACE: Access Control Entry) をカプセル化ます。すべての KnownAce オブジェクトには、32 ビットアクセス マスクSecurityIdentifier オブジェクト格納されます。
パブリック クラスMutexAccessRuleユーザーまたはグループ許可されアクセス権セットまたは拒否されアクセス権セット表します。このクラス継承できません。
パブリック クラスMutexAuditRuleユーザーまたはグループについて監査するアクセス権セット表します。このクラス継承できません。
パブリック クラスMutexSecurity前付ミューテックスWindows アクセス制御セキュリティ表します。このクラス継承できません。
パブリック クラスNativeObjectSecurityアクセス制御リスト (ACL: Access Control List) を直接操作せずにネイティブオブジェクトへのアクセス制御する機能提供しますネイティブオブジェクト型は、ResourceType 列挙体で定義されます。
パブリック クラスObjectAccessRuleユーザー IDアクセス マスクアクセス制御種類 (許可または拒否) の組み合わせ表します。ObjectAccessRule オブジェクトにも、規則適用するオブジェクトの型、その規則継承できる子オブジェクトの型、子オブジェクトによる規則継承方法、および継承反映方法に関する情報格納されます。
パブリック クラスObjectAceディレクトリ サービス オブジェクトへのアクセス制御します。このクラスは、ディレクトリ オブジェクト関連付けられたアクセス制御エントリ (ACE: Access Control Entry) を表します
パブリック クラスObjectAuditRuleユーザー IDアクセス マスク、および監査条件組み合わせ表します。ObjectAuditRule オブジェクトには、規則適用するオブジェクトの型、その規則継承できる子オブジェクトの型、子オブジェクトによる規則継承方法、および継承反映方法に関する情報格納されます。
パブリック クラスObjectSecurityアクセス制御リスト (ACL: Access Control List) を直接操作せずにオブジェクトへのアクセス制御する機能提供します。このクラスは、CommonObjectSecurity クラスおよび DirectoryObjectSecurity クラス抽象基本クラスです。
パブリック クラスPrivilegeNotHeldExceptionSystem.Security.AccessControl 名前空間内のメソッドが、そのメソッド設定されていない特権有効にようとするスローされる例外
パブリック クラスQualifiedAce修飾子を含むアクセス制御エントリ (ACE: Access Control Entry) を表します。AceQualifier オブジェクト表される修飾子は、ACE によるアクセス許可アクセス拒否システム監査実行、またはシステム アラーム発生指定します。QualifiedAce クラスは、CommonAce クラスおよび ObjectAce クラス抽象基本クラスです。
パブリック クラスRawAclアクセス制御リスト (ACL: Access Control List) を表します
パブリック クラスRawSecurityDescriptorセキュリティ記述子表しますセキュリティ記述子には、所有者プライマリ グループ随意アクセス制御リスト (DACL: Discretionary Access Control List)、システム アクセス制御リスト (SACL: System Access Control List) が含まれます。
パブリック クラスRegistryAccessRuleユーザーまたはグループ許可されアクセス権セットまたは拒否されアクセス権セット表します。このクラス継承できません。
パブリック クラスRegistryAuditRuleユーザーまたはグループについて監査するアクセス権セット表します。このクラス継承できません。
パブリック クラスRegistrySecurityレジストリ キーWindows アクセス制御セキュリティ表します。このクラス継承できません。
パブリック クラスSemaphoreAccessRuleユーザーまたはグループ許可されアクセス権セットまたは拒否されアクセス権セット表します。このクラス継承できません。
パブリック クラスSemaphoreAuditRuleユーザーまたはグループについて監査するアクセス権セット表します。このクラス継承できません。
パブリック クラスSemaphoreSecurity前付セマフォWindows アクセス制御セキュリティ表します。このクラス継承できません。
パブリック クラスSystemAclシステム アクセス制御リスト (SACL: System Access Control List) を表します
デリゲートデリゲート
 デリゲート説明
パブリック デリゲートNativeObjectSecurity.ExceptionFromErrorCodeインテグレータが作成した特定の例外数値エラー コードマップする方法提供します
列挙型列挙型
 列挙説明
パブリック列挙体AccessControlActionsセキュリティ設定できるオブジェクト許可されアクション指定します
パブリック列挙体AccessControlModification実行するアクセス制御変更種類指定します。この列挙体は ObjectSecurity クラスその子孫クラスメソッド使用されます。
パブリック列挙体AccessControlSections保存するセキュリティ記述子セクション、または読み込むセキュリティ記述子セクション指定します
パブリック列挙体AccessControlTypeアクセス許可または拒否AccessRule オブジェクト使用するかどうか指定します。これらの値はフラグではありません。また、これらの値を組み合わせることはできません。
パブリック列挙体AceFlagsアクセス制御エントリ (ACE: Access Control Entry) の継承監査に関する動作指定します
パブリック列挙体AceQualifierアクセス制御エントリ (ACE: Access Control Entry) の機能指定します
パブリック列挙体AceType使用可能なアクセス制御エントリ (ACE: Access Control Entry) の型を定義します
パブリック列挙体AuditFlagsセキュリティ設定できるオブジェクトへのアクセス試行監査する条件指定します
パブリック列挙体CompoundAceTypeCompoundAce オブジェクトの型を指定します
パブリック列挙体ControlFlagsこれらのフラグは、セキュリティ記述子動作影響します
パブリック列挙体CryptoKeyRights承認規則アクセスまたは監査制御する暗号化キー操作指定します
パブリック列挙体EventWaitHandleRights前付システム イベント オブジェクト適用できるアクセス制御指定します
パブリック列挙体FileSystemRightsアクセス規則監査規則作成時に使用するアクセス権定義します
パブリック列挙体InheritanceFlags継承フラグでは、アクセス制御エントリ (ACE: Access Control Entry) の継承セマンティクス指定します
パブリック列挙体MutexRights前付システム ミューテックス オブジェクト適用できるアクセス制御指定します
パブリック列挙体ObjectAceFlagsアクセス制御エントリ (ACE: Access Control Entry) のオブジェクトの型が存在するかどうか示します
パブリック列挙体PropagationFlagsアクセス制御エントリ (ACE: Access Control Entry) を子オブジェクト反映させる方法指定します。これらのフラグ継承フラグ存在する場合だけに意味を持ちます
パブリック列挙体RegistryRightsレジストリ オブジェクト適用できるアクセス制御指定します
パブリック列挙体ResourceType定義済みネイティブオブジェクト型指定します
パブリック列挙体SecurityInfos照会または設定するセキュリティ記述子セクション指定します
パブリック列挙体SemaphoreRights前付システム セマフォ オブジェクト適用できるアクセス制御指定します


このページでは「.NET Framework クラス ライブラリ リファレンス」からSystem.Security.AccessControl 名前空間を検索した結果を表示しています。
Weblioに収録されているすべての辞書からSystem.Security.AccessControl 名前空間を検索する場合は、下記のリンクをクリックしてください。
 全ての辞書からSystem.Security.AccessControl 名前空間 を検索

英和和英テキスト翻訳>> Weblio翻訳
英語⇒日本語日本語⇒英語
  

辞書ショートカット

すべての辞書の索引

「System.Security.AccessControl 名前空間」の関連用語

System.Security.AccessControl 名前空間のお隣キーワード
検索ランキング

   

英語⇒日本語
日本語⇒英語
   



System.Security.AccessControl 名前空間のページの著作権
Weblio 辞書 情報提供元は 参加元一覧 にて確認できます。

   
日本マイクロソフト株式会社日本マイクロソフト株式会社
© 2025 Microsoft.All rights reserved.

©2025 GRAS Group, Inc.RSS